Pease Place Community Playground

In 2009, two moms in Woodbridge Connecticut decided that the town could use a new and improved playground that would be exciting for children both young and old and accessible for ALL children. They wanted to ensure that no matter a child’s ability, they would have an opportunity to interact and play with their peers. […]

Miracle League Barrier Free Playground

Last Father’s Day, there was a special dedication ceremony in West Hartford.  After years of hard work and fundraising efforts, the first Miracle League field in New England opened in West Hartford. The complex included not only the Miracle League field but also several fields for the West Hartford Little League and a barrier free […]
